How Scientists Are Preparing for Apophis’s Unnervingly Close Brush With Earth
In about five years’ time, a potentially hazardous asteroid will swing by Earth at an eerily close distance of less than 20,000 miles (32,000 kilometers). NASA Needs Ideas to Study Potentially Hazardous Asteroid Apophis
Asteroid 99942 Apophis is fast approaching our home planet for an uncomfortably close encounter in 2029. In order to prepare for the rare event, NASA is calling for ideas for low cost missions to rendezvous with Apophis, but the space agency already has a pair of asteroid probes ready to take on the task. NASA Probe Transmits Groundbreaking Laser Message From 10 Million Miles Away
A gold-capped laser transceiver attached to the asteroid probe Psyche saw its first light on Tuesday, sending and receiving data through laser beams from far beyond the Moon for the first time. NASA Fixes Psyche Spacecraft’s Thruster Issue Just in Time for Launch
NASA’s mission to a metal-rich asteroid is back on track after a minor setback. Psyche is now all set to launch on October 12. A week before the original scheduled launch, engineers discovered an issue with the Psyche spacecraft’s thrusters that could have caused it to overheat during its eight-year mission.
